Why practitioners start looking

The complaints are consistent, and almost none of them are about whether the software works. They are about fit.

Pricing is quote-led, not published

Mindbody packages are typically scoped by location, staff count, and add-ons rather than listed as a self-serve monthly price. Small practices often want to know the number before they book a demo.

Built for volume you may not have

Class schedules, retail inventory, memberships, and staff management are real strengths at studio scale. A solo practitioner or a three-person healing collective is paying for surface area they never open.

Marketplace distribution cuts both ways

The Mindbody app and partner networks can bring new clients in — and can also put your listing beside competitors while your regulars book through a channel you do not own.

Onboarding assumes a front desk

Configuration and staff training are worth it when someone runs the schedule full time. When you are the practitioner and the admin, setup time is billable time you lost.

Acuity Scheduling
Best for: Flexible general scheduling, especially on Squarespace

A mature, highly configurable appointment scheduler now owned by Squarespace. Strong on custom intake forms, appointment types, and calendar logic. The trade-off is that nothing in it is wellness-specific — messaging, class handling, and client experience are generic, and you assemble the practice workflow yourself.

Square Appointments
Best for: Practices that live on Square POS

The natural choice if you already take in-person card payments on Square hardware and want bookings in the same account. Salon and spa oriented rather than healing oriented, with limited support for sliding scale or ceremony-style group events.

Vagaro
Best for: Salons, spas, and multi-station wellness businesses

A close functional substitute for Mindbody in the salon and spa category, with published pricing that scales by bookable staff. It includes a marketplace, payroll-style staff tooling, and retail — genuinely useful at that scale, and the same weight a solo practitioner was trying to shed.

WellnessLiving
Best for: Studios that want the closest Mindbody feature match

Positioned directly against Mindbody and frequently evaluated by studios switching rather than downsizing. If you need the class, membership, and marketing depth and only want different pricing or support, this is the like-for-like move. Pricing is typically demo-led.

WellnessLiving alternatives
SimplePractice
Best for: Licensed clinicians who need an EHR

The right answer when insurance billing, superbills, and clinical documentation are requirements — common for therapists, and for acupuncturists and massage therapists in clinical settings. Overkill for energy work, readings, or ceremony-based practices that never chart.

When you should stay on Mindbody

Switching costs real time. If any of these describe your business, the honest answer is that Mindbody is probably still the better tool.

  • You run multiple locations and need one operational system across all of them.
  • Marketplace and partner-network discovery is a meaningful share of new client acquisition.
  • Retail, memberships, and staff scheduling are core daily operations, not occasional extras.
  • Your team is trained on Mindbody and the switching cost outweighs the monthly savings.

How to switch without losing bookings

The same four steps apply whichever platform you land on.

1

Export your client list first

Pull contacts, and any visit history you can, out of your current platform before you cancel. This is the asset that is hardest to rebuild and the one most practitioners forget until the account closes.

2

Rebuild services, not the whole schedule

Recreate your session types with their durations, prices, and buffers. Availability rules are faster to set fresh than to migrate, and most practitioners find their old schedule had drifted anyway.

3

Run both in parallel for a booking cycle

Keep the old system live for existing appointments while new bookings come through the new one. Nobody's session gets lost, and you find configuration gaps on your own time.

4

Move your booking link everywhere at once

Instagram bio, Google Business Profile, email signature, website. Clients follow the link they last used, so a half-finished switch means months of split bookings.

What do you lose by switching away from Mindbody?

Mainly three things: marketplace and partner-network discovery, deep retail and membership tooling, and multi-location operational management. If none of those drive your business, you lose very little. If any one of them is a real acquisition or operations channel, price the replacement before you move.

Can I move my client list off Mindbody?

Export your client contacts and available visit history before you cancel, while your account is still active. Most platforms — Flowdara included — let you rebuild services, availability, and intake forms during onboarding and then share a new booking link with existing clients.
